I received a check engine light which I took to bell tire for diagnosis. Here is there diagnosis comments: the p01f0 code on a 2020 chevy Blazer means the engine coolant temperature is below the normal operating range, often due to a stuck-open thermostat (or both thermostats in models with dual units), a faulty engine coolant temperature (ect) sensor, or low coolant, leading to poor fuel economy and potential wear; fixing it usually involves replacing the thermostat(s) or sensor after checking coolant levels and wiring. After that I took the vehicle to gm dealership. Even though this is a know issue with many vehicles from same year, I was told that my VIN is not part of recall and dealership ended up charging me 600+ to fix the issue. I am reaching out to seek help as I had exact same problem but gm is not covering the repairs because my VIN is not in the recall. How is that possible?.

Driving the vehicle when all of a sudden the engine shut off. All electrical systems continued to function. Luckily this occurred at low speed in a parking lot but had it happened at high speed on the freeway it could have been a huge safety risk. The vehicle was towed to a nearby automotive shop that diagnosed it as a bad fuel pump controller. There is an open gm recall that includes the 2021 chevy Blazer (and a suite of other gm vehicles), but not the 2022 chevy Blazer. I am concerned that the gm recall does not fully cover all of the vehicles that could be impacted by this issue. On Friday, April 28, 2023, at about 11:30 am, my car, died as I was driving it out of the grocery store parking lot; luckily, it didn’t happen as I was crossing the busy highway. I attempted several times to restart it, with no luck. There were no warning lamps, messages or other symptoms of this problem. The vehicle was in the middle of an aisle, blocking the aisle and many cars in parking spots, so I managed to get it into neutral and it backed around into parking spaces where the left rear quarter stopped against the front tire of a Ford f-350. I was actually thankful for the truck as I had no steering or brakes, and I was on a slight hill heading towards the road. I had it towed to the dealership, which was unable to tell me what the problem was before I obtained a ride home at 3:30 pm and that they would call me when they had it figured out. When I returned home, my husband had searched the internet for recalls for the car and was unable to locate any. I called the service department the next day, Saturday April 29, and was told that the problem was the fuel pump control module, which was under warranty, and it could be 3 months before it was fixed as they didn’t have one, and there was a large backorder. The fuel pump module was recalled on other gm vehicles gm #n212382040 and NHTSA campaign #21v739000, and there was another recall by gm on February 6, 2023 recall #n222372310 that did not include the chevy Blazer.

The fuel gage sensor system becomes faulty after 74,000 miles. Mine started at approx. 90,000 miles. I have learned online this has happened to many 2002 Blazer owners & gm will not address the issue. Because of this the cars will not pass emissions due to a diagnostic trouble code & costs over $1,000 to repair on a 12 year old vehicle even thought it has nothing to do with the actual emission output. It is one thing to have parts break down with age and quite another to have the same part become faulty on a large scale. I cannot renew my plates due to the emission failure and cannot afford to fix a gage for a $1,000. Gm needs to recall the vehicles and admit their fault using a cheap faulty part to save $$.
